P2P

This package implements the P2P networking layer for Aztec nodes using libp2p. It handles transaction propagation, block and checkpoint proposal dissemination, attestation collection for consensus, and peer management. The P2PClient provides the top-level interface used by aztec-node; the BootstrapNode class runs a lightweight discovery-only node that introduces peers to the network without participating in gossip.

Architecture

  • P2PClient wraps everything below. Manages lifecycle, bridges L2 block events to pool state transitions, exposes ITxProvider for RPC.
  • LibP2PService is the core networking layer. Subscribes to gossipsub topics, registers req/resp handlers, runs message validation pipelines. It composes:
    • PeerManager — peer scoring (gossipsub + application-level), authentication (STATUS/AUTH handshakes), connection gating.
    • DiscV5Service — UDP-based peer discovery using Ethereum's discv5 protocol and ENR records.
    • ReqResp — request-response protocols: BLOCK_TXS, TX, STATUS, AUTH, PING, GOODBYE.
    • TxCollection — coordinates transaction fetching: fast collection for proposals/proving (deadline-driven, falls back to BatchTxRequester) and slow background collection for unproven blocks.
  • Mempools sit below the service layer:
    • TxPoolV2 — transaction mempool with explicit state machine (pending, protected, mined, soft-deleted, hard-deleted) and pluggable eviction rules.
    • AttestationPool — stores block/checkpoint proposals and attestations per slot. Handles equivocation detection and slash callbacks.

Peer Lifecycle
Unknown → [DiscV5 discovery] → Discovered → [TCP connect] → Connected
  → [STATUS or AUTH handshake] → Authenticated → [gossip participation] → Active

Handshake type depends on config:

  • p2pAllowOnlyValidators = true and peer is not protected: AUTH handshake (signature challenge proving validator identity). Unauthenticated peers get appSpecificScore = -Infinity, excluding them from all gossip.
  • Otherwise: STATUS handshake (version compatibility check only).
  • Protected peers (trusted/private/preferred): STATUS only, always considered authenticated.

Connection gating: peers with too many failed AUTH attempts (p2pMaxFailedAuthAttemptsAllowed, default 3) are denied inbound connections for 1 hour.

Gossipsub Objects

All gossipsub messages pass through a shared pre-validation pipeline before topic-specific logic:

Stage Rule Consequence File
0 Snappy decompressed size <= per-topic limit (see per-object sections) Message dropped p2p/src/services/encoding.ts
1 P2PMessage envelope deserializes REJECT + LowToleranceError p2p/src/services/libp2p/libp2p_service.ts
2 Gossipsub-level message cache dedup (configurable seenTTL) Silently dropped by gossipsub gossipsub internals
3 Application-level dedup via MessageSeenValidator (fixed-size circular buffer + Set) IGNORE p2p/src/msg_validators/msg_seen_validator/

A REJECT result from any validation stage increments the gossipsub P4 (invalidMessageDeliveries) counter for the peer on that topic. P4 weight is -20, decaying over 4 slots. This is in addition to any application-level peer penalty.

Peer Penalty Severity Reference
Severity Approx. strikes to ban Used for
LowToleranceError ~2 Invalid proof, deserialization failure, old double-spend
MidToleranceError ~10 Most validation failures (metadata, data, gas, phases, size)
HighToleranceError ~50 Timestamp expiry, block header, recent double-spend, rate limits

Object Summary
Topic Snappy Limit Description Detailed Docs
tx 512 KB Transactions. Two-stage validation: fast validators (parallel) then proof verification. Pool pre-check between stages avoids wasting CPU on proof for txs the pool would reject. Tx Validation
block_proposal 10 MB Block proposals from proposers. Validated for slot timing, signature, proposer identity, tx hash integrity. Validator nodes may re-execute and slash on state mismatch. Proposal Validation
checkpoint_proposal 10 MB Checkpoint proposals containing the final block. Same proposal validation as blocks, plus embedded block extraction and separate validation. Proposal Validation
checkpoint_attestation 5 KB Validator attestations for checkpoints. Validated for slot timing, attester/proposer signatures, committee membership. Equivocation at count=2 triggers slash callback. Attestation Validation

Rate Limits (Responder Side)
Protocol Peer Limit Global Limit
PING 5/s 10/s
STATUS 5/s 10/s
AUTH 5/s 10/s
GOODBYE 5/s 10/s
BLOCK_TXS 10/s 200/s
TX 10/s 200/s

Per-peer limit exceeded: HighToleranceError + RATE_LIMIT_EXCEEDED status. Global limit exceeded: RATE_LIMIT_EXCEEDED status only (no peer penalty).

Peer Score Thresholds
Score State Action
> -50 Healthy Normal
-100 < score <= -50 Disconnect GOODBYE sent + disconnect on next heartbeat
<= -100 Banned GOODBYE sent + disconnect on next heartbeat; banned for P2P_PEER_BAN_DURATION_SECONDS (default 24h)

Once a peer is banned its score is pinned at the ban level for the configured duration (it does not decay-recover), and only lifts when the window expires. See Gossipsub Scoring for details.

Protocol Summary
Protocol Request Response Purpose
STATUS Own blockchain state Peer's blockchain state Version compatibility check on connect
AUTH Random challenge (Fr) Signed challenge response Validator identity verification on connect
PING (empty) pong Liveness check
GOODBYE Reason byte (none meaningful) Graceful disconnect
BLOCK_TXS Archive root + tx hashes + BitVector Txs + BitVector of availability Batch tx fetching for proposals/proving
TX TxHashArray Matching txs Individual tx fetching

Request payloads are NOT snappy-compressed (asymmetric: only responses use snappy).
